flag A lawsuit filed in December 2025 accuses the Trump administration of violating the Freedom of Information Act by withholding documents on asbestos abatement during the October 2025 demolition of the White House East Wing. flag The project, part of a $400 million ballroom expansion funded by private donors linked to the Trump campaign, proceeded without public notification or disclosure of safety protocols, raising health and environmental concerns. flag Despite the White House claiming abatement was completed in September, federal agencies have not released verification, and visible dust and soil transport to a nearby golf course have sparked fears of asbestos exposure. flag The EPA and lawmakers have criticized the lack of transparency, with officials calling it a breach of public trust and potentially dangerous. flag A public meeting is scheduled for Thursday before the National Capital Planning Commission.
